Author Biography
Candy Campbell, DNP, RN, CNL, CEP, FNAP, international speaker, award winning actor, filmmaker, and author; works with individuals and corporations to improve interprofessional communication, leadership, and team development. As an actress, she has appeared on stage, TV, film, commercials, voice-overs, and the Internet.
She co-founded an improv and standup comedy troupe, The Barely Insane Players, which led to the creation of three solo shows, Whatever Happened to My Paradigm? Full-Frontal Nursing: A Comedy With Dark Spots and Florence Nightingale-Live!
